Re: We Need a SNES Section - Please Vote

Hi BrownCan & welcome to the forums

The SNES was indeed a great console, infact still is if you still own one The thing is once a console is superceeded and the releases stop, it doesn't tend to get talked about very much, at least not to warrent its own sub-forum.

The N64 was also highly regarded as great console by many people but likewise does not get discussed much now with exception the odd thread now and then.

Here on the forums we try to only keep sub-forums that are at least fairly active, if they only receive the occasional post every few weeks(or even months) then they only serve to seperate themselves from the sections that people view more regularly, hence the reason for the general Nintendo forum where any console or handheld not included in the sub-forum list can be discussed.

Of course if you wish to open a SNES thread to remeber the classics etc. then feel free to do so, you'll likely get a few people join in to share and discuss their favourites.
